System Designing Tutorial

System designing is a multifaceted process that requires a systematic approach to ensure the successful development of software systems. It involves various stages, including requirement analysis, architectural design, database design, interface design, and more. A well-designed system not only meets the current needs of the users but also allows for future scalability and maintainability.

To begin with, the system designing tutorial starts with understanding the requirements of the system. This involves gathering information from stakeholders, analyzing user needs, and defining the scope of the project. Once the requirements are clear, the next step is to create a high-level design that outlines the overall structure of the system, including the modules, components, and their interactions.

System Design Step by Step

The system design process is typically broken down into several steps to ensure a systematic and organized approach. These steps include:

1. Requirement Analysis: Gather and analyze user requirements to understand the functionalities and constraints of the system.

2. System Architecture Design: Define the overall structure of the system, including the components, modules, and their interactions.

3. Database Design: Design the database schema and relationships to store and retrieve data efficiently.

4. Interface Design: Create user interfaces that are intuitive, responsive, and user-friendly.

5. Security Design: Implement security measures to protect the system from unauthorized access and data breaches.

6. Scalability and Performance: Ensure that the system can handle increasing loads and maintain optimal performance.

7. Testing and Validation: Test the system design to identify and fix any issues or bugs before deployment.
